Equinox Gold Corp. has announced the commencement of early works construction at its South Railroad project in Nevada, following the acquisition of a key federal permit. The U.S. Bureau of Land Management (BLM) issued a positive Record of Decision (ROD), completing the federal National Environmental Policy Act (NEPA) permitting process. This milestone marks a significant step forward for the company, enabling it to advance state permits and water rights applications as it moves towards full-scale development.

Progress on South Railroad: A Strategic Milestone

The South Railroad project, situated in Nevada, represents a substantial opportunity for Equinox Gold. The project is poised to become a significant contributor to the company’s production profile, targeting an annual output of approximately 130,000 ounces of gold for the first five years. This is supported by an initial capital investment of around $395 million. According to Equinox’s investor presentation, detailed engineering and supplier engagement are already well advanced, laying the groundwork for the construction phase to accelerate following permit approval.

Prior to the ROD issuance, the South Railroad project was advancing through the BLM’s FAST-41 process, a framework designed to streamline the federal environmental review and permitting timeline. The project dashboard had previously indicated an estimated completion date for federal environmental review by August 31, 2026. The issuance of the ROD marks the completion of this phase, allowing Equinox to initiate early construction activities.

Strategic Implications of the Federal Permit

The granting of the ROD is particularly noteworthy as it is the first major federal permitting milestone for Equinox since its merger with Orla Mining in July. This merger has fortified Equinox’s position, enhancing its project pipeline and operational capabilities. The South Railroad project, with its substantial gold production potential, is expected to play a pivotal role in the company’s growth strategy.

Next Steps and Industry Impact

In the coming months, Equinox Gold plans to increase its workforce at the South Railroad site, as well as to continue with detailed engineering and the procurement of essential materials and services. The company has stated its intention to secure all necessary state permits and finalize water rights applications, which are vital for the sustainable operation of the project.
